Compact 300sqm lot | modern 2017-era build | parkland proximity | downsizer/investor appeal | low-maintenance family living This property sits within a modern pocket of Beeliar where compact detached houses on small lots have been built to a mid-market contemporary standard, with stone benchtops, solar panels, and secure parking as recurring features. The configuration of three to four bedrooms with two bathrooms and double garage on a low-maintenance 300sqm block is well suited to downsizers seeking to trade garden upkeep for lock-and-leave convenience, first home buyers wanting a newer build without the premium of a larger estate, and investors targeting the reliable rental demand that comes with FTTP internet, school proximity, and parkland outlooks. The 2017-era construction means the property avoids the compliance and efficiency shortcomings of older stock while still offering established landscaping and street character that newer estates often lack. The compact lot size may limit appeal for families wanting generous outdoor space or buyers accustomed to the larger land parcels found elsewhere in Beeliar, and the standardised project-home build quality means finishes are functional rather than premium. The absence of a dedicated sales record for this exact address means the price point should be tested against what similar modern houses on the street have transacted for, and any premium for parkland frontage or aspect would need to be verified on inspection. The property’s position within a planned estate suggests consistent neighbourhood character but also limited scope for future subdivision or land value appreciation beyond the house itself.

Market Insight

Beeliar is a family-oriented suburb with a young demographic, firmly positioned within Perth’s high-demand southern corridor. Demand is driven by owner-occupying families, supported by the broader market’s persistent housing shortage and strong population growth. Recent price trends show robust and accelerating growth, particularly for units, within a fast-moving market. Future performance is underpinned by Perth’s structural supply constraints, though affordability pressures and interest rate sensitivity present notable risks given the high proportion of mortgaged owners.
